. Rafael Zabaleta. Born November 6, 1907, Quesada, Jaén, Spain – Died June 24, 1960, Quesada, Jaén, Spain . Rafael Zabaleta was born in 1907 in Quesada, Jaén, into a wealthy family with Basque roots. He showed an early passion for painting and, in 1925, moved to Madrid to study at the Escuela Superior de Bellas Artes de San Fernando, where his instructors included Laínez Alcalá, Cecilio Pla, and Ignacio Pinazo. Zabaleta’s first group exhibition took place in 1932, and his painting La pareja was selected to illustrate a review by Manuel Abril in Blanco y Negro magazine. In 1935, he traveled to Paris, where he studied the works of contemporary masters, an experience that would deeply influence his evolving style.
